About the Role
We are seeking a highly motivated and technically strong Technical Lead to join our AI Productivity Centre of Excellence. This role combines hands-on engineering, technical leadership, and client engagement to deliver AI-enabled productivity solutions.
As a Lead you will drive full-stack development, influence architectural decisions, mentor engineers, and actively contribute to innovation initiatives around GenAI and developer productivity.
This is a client-facing role, requiring strong communication skills to present solutions, lead technical discussions, and bridge business and engineering needs.
Key Responsibilities
1. Technical Leadership & Delivery
- Lead end-to-end design and development of scalable full-stack applications
- Drive architectural decisions and enforce engineering best practices
- Translate business requirements into robust technical solutions
- Contribute hands-on to critical modules, PoCs, and production code
- Collaborate with architects to ensure alignment with enterprise standards
2. Team Mentorship & Development
- Mentor junior and mid-level engineers on coding standards and design patterns
- Conduct effective code reviews to improve overall code quality
- Support sprint planning, estimation, and technical breakdowns
- Identify skill gaps and drive continuous learning within the team
3. Client Engagement & Communication
- Present technical solutions, demos, and progress updates to stakeholders
- Act as a bridge between business requirements and engineering execution
- Lead technical discussions in client meetings and agile ceremonies
- Prepare clear documentation and technical presentations
4. AI Productivity & Innovation
- Explore and integrate AI/GenAI tools to enhance engineering productivity
- Apply prompt engineering techniques in development workflows
- Stay updated with emerging trends in LLMs and AI-assisted development
- Contribute to CoE innovation, R&D, and knowledge-sharing initiatives
Mandatory Skills
Backend Development (Any One)
- .NET Core / ASP.NET – C#, REST APIs, Entity Framework
- Java (Spring Boot) – Spring MVC, JPA/Hibernate
- Node.js – Express/NestJS, REST & event-driven architectures
Full-Stack Development
- Frontend: React / Angular / Vue.js with TypeScript, HTML, CSS
- Strong experience in API design, integration, and consumption
- Ability to independently own end-to-end application development
Cloud Platforms (Any One)
- AWS: EC2, S3, Lambda, RDS, API Gateway, IAM
- Azure: App Services, Functions, DevOps, Azure AI
Communication Skills
- Strong verbal and written communication
- Proven client-facing and presentation experience
- Ability to communicate effectively with technical and business stakeholders
Required Technical Expertise
Architecture & Design
- Strong knowledge of design patterns (SOLID, MVC, DI, Repository)
- Experience with microservices and distributed architectures
- Ability to evaluate and justify architectural decisions
DevOps & CI/CD
- Experience with CI/CD tools (GitHub Actions, Azure DevOps, Jenkins)
- Working knowledge of Docker and containerization
- Strong understanding of Git workflows and code reviews
Agile Practices
- Experience in Agile (Scrum/Kanban/SAFe) environments
- Active participation in sprint ceremonies and delivery lifecycle
- Familiarity with Jira, Azure Boards, or similar tools
GenAI Fundamentals
- Basic understanding of LLMs and their applications
- Exposure to prompt engineering techniques
- Familiarity with tools like GitHub Copilot, ChatGPT, etc.
Preferred Qualifications
- AWS / Azure certifications
- Experience with serverless architectures (Lambda, Azure Functions)
- Knowledge of Infrastructure as Code (Terraform, Bicep, CloudFormation)
- Understanding of security best practices (OAuth2, JWT, OWASP Top 10)
- Experience with SQL & NoSQL databases (PostgreSQL, MongoDB, etc.)
- Participation in CoE initiatives or knowledge-sharing programs
Technology Stack
AreaTechnologiesBackend.NET Core, Java Spring Boot, Node.jsFrontendReact, Angular, TypeScriptCloudAWS, AzureAI/GenAILLMs, Prompt Engineering, CopilotDevOpsDocker, Jenkins, GitHub ActionsDataSQL, PostgreSQL, MongoDBToolsJira, Confluence, VS Code, IntelliJ